USDA's $77M Agile Teams Contract Awarded to Alethix, LLC for Conservation Financial Assistance Support

Contract Overview

Contract Amount: $77,112,502 ($77.1M)

Contractor: Alethix, LLC

Awarding Agency: Department of Agriculture

Start Date: 2020-09-29

End Date: 2023-01-16

Contract Duration: 839 days

Daily Burn Rate: $91.9K/day

Competition Type: FULL AND OPEN COMPETITION

Pricing Type: FIRM FIXED PRICE

Sector: IT

Official Description: ELM 4 CALL ORDER MONEY ART O&M THIS CALL ORDER IS TO ACQUIRE AGILE TEAMS SKILLED AND EXPERIENCED WITH THE TECHNOLOGIES INDICATED IN THIS SOO. THE SCOPE OF THIS EFFORT SUPPORTS CONSERVATION FINANCIAL ASSISTANCE AND FARM BILL UPDATES OR OTHER LE

Competition Analysis

Competition Level: full-and-open

The contract was awarded under full and open competition, suggesting a competitive bidding process. However, the specific mechanism (BPA Call) implies that the initial competition for the BPA itself may have influenced the pricing for this call order.
